AI Summary
-
Commissioner of Administrative Services must offer surplus state motor vehicles from the interagency motor pool to qualified veterans' charitable organizations for no more than $2,000 when the vehicles cannot be transferred, sold, or donated through other means.
-
Qualified veterans' charitable organizations receiving vehicles must identify veterans who have performed service in time of war, have a service-connected disability rated by the U.S. Department of Veterans Affairs, and have demonstrated financial need.
-
Qualified veterans' charitable organizations must donate the vehicles to eligible veterans and pay any Department of Motor Vehicles administrative costs or fees associated with transferring the vehicle title.
-
The act takes effect October 1, 2018, and amends section 4a-57a(a) of the general statutes while creating a new provision governing the vehicle donation process.
Legislative Description
An Act Concerning The Offering Of Certain Motor Vehicles From The State Motor Pool To Qualified Veterans' Charitable Organizations.
